What methods can be used to verify the CAP theorem in distributed systems?

sobes.tech AI

Answer from AI

The CAP theorem states that in a distributed system, it is impossible to guarantee all three properties simultaneously: Consistency, Availability, and Partition Tolerance. This theorem can be confirmed through the following methods:

  1. Theoretical analysis — formal proof of the impossibility to ensure all three properties simultaneously in the presence of network partitions.

  2. Experimental modeling — creating prototypes of distributed systems where, during network failures, it is observed that either consistency or availability must be sacrificed.

  3. Analysis of real systems — studying the behavior of existing distributed databases and services (e.g., Cassandra, MongoDB, etcd), which choose different trade-offs among CAP properties.

  4. Use of formal models and simulations — applying models such as TLA+ or Petri nets for formal analysis of system behavior during network partitions.

Thus, confirming the CAP theorem is achieved through a combination of theoretical proofs and practical experiments with distributed systems.
